Output 13ba46850958738440cd85fe19331e19cb44f05aaa3846ef6ca9f13fa1e47442:0

value
63153683
script pubkey
OP_0 OP_PUSHBYTES_20 dd7057f83f870f4ad87c05ad0c61ea238f8f9f3a
address
ltc1qm4c907plsu854kruqkkscc02yw8cl8e6prcr8x
transaction
13ba46850958738440cd85fe19331e19cb44f05aaa3846ef6ca9f13fa1e47442
spent
true